On 05/12/2018 04:54 AM, Jacob Pan wrote:
> IO page faults can be handled outside IOMMU subsystem. For an example,
> when nested translation is turned on and guest owns the
> first level page tables, device page request can be forwared
> to the guest for handling faults. As the page response returns
> by the guest, IOMMU driver on the host need to process the
> response which informs the device and completes the page request
> transaction.
>
> This patch introduces generic API function for page response
> passing from the guest or other in-kernel users. The definitions of
> the generic data is based on PCI ATS specification not limited to
> any vendor.

> +int iommu_page_response(struct device *dev,
> + struct page_response_msg *msg)
> +{
> + struct iommu_param *param = dev->iommu_param;
> + int ret = -EINVAL;
> + struct iommu_fault_event *evt;
> + struct iommu_domain *domain = iommu_get_domain_for_dev(dev);
> +
> + if (!domain || !domain->ops->page_response)
> + return -ENODEV;
> +
> + /*
> + * Device iommu_param should have been allocated when device is
> + * added to its iommu_group.
> + */
> + if (!param || !param->fault_param)
> + return -EINVAL;
> +
> + /* Only send response if there is a fault report pending */
> + mutex_lock(¶m->fault_param->lock);
> + if (list_empty(¶m->fault_param->faults)) {
> + pr_warn("no pending PRQ, drop response\n");
> + goto done_unlock;
> + }
> + /*
> + * Check if we have a matching page request pending to respond,
> + * otherwise return -EINVAL
> + */
> + list_for_each_entry(evt, ¶m->fault_param->faults, list) {
> + if (evt->pasid == msg->pasid &&
> + msg->page_req_group_id == evt->page_req_group_id) {
> + msg->private_data = evt->iommu_private;
> + ret = domain->ops->page_response(dev, msg);
> + list_del(&evt->list);
> + kfree(evt);
> + break;
> + }
> + }
Are above two checks duplicated? We won't find a matching
request if the list is empty. And we need to printk a message
if we can't find the matching request.

> /**
> + * enum page_response_code - Return status of fault handlers, telling the IOMMU
> + * driver how to proceed with the fault.
> + *
> + * @I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_SUCCESS: Fault has been handled and the page tables
> + * populated, retry the access. This is "Success" in PCI PRI.
> + * @I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_FAILURE: General error. Drop all subsequent faults from
> + * this device if possible. This is "Response Failure" in PCI PRI.
> + * @I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_INVALID: Could not handle this fault, don't retry the
> + * access. This is "Invalid Request" in PCI PRI.
> + */
> +enum page_response_code {
> + I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_SUCCESS = 0,
> + I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_INVALID,
> + IOMMU_PAGE_RESP_FAILURE,
> +};
> +
> +/**
> + * Generic page response information based on PCI ATS and PASID spec.
> + * @addr: servicing page address
> + * @pasid: contains process address space ID
> + * @resp_code: response code
> + * @page_req_group_id: page request group index
> + * @private_data: uniquely identify device-specific private data for an
> + * individual page response
> + */
> +struct page_response_msg {
> + u64 addr;
> + u32 pasid;
> + enum page_response_code resp_code;
> + u32 pasid_present:1;
> + u32 page_req_group_id;
> + u64 private_data;
> +};
